Drinking Water Filtration in Austin, TX
Drinking water filtration services involve installing and maintaining systems designed to improve the quality and safety of tap water for residential properties. These services typically cover the installation of point-of-use filters, whole-house filtration systems, and upgrades to existing setups to remove contaminants such as chlorine, sediments, heavy metals, and other impurities. Homeowners often seek these services to ensure their drinking water is clean, tastes better, and meets health standards, especially in areas where water quality may vary or contain common pollutants.
Before requesting drinking water filtration services, property owners usually want to understand the types of filtration options available and which system best suits their household needs. It’s also helpful to consider the specific contaminants present in the local water supply, the maintenance requirements of different systems, and the overall cost of installation and upkeep. Clarifying these details can help homeowners make informed decisions to improve their water quality and enjoy safer, better-tasting drinking water.

Drinking Water Filtration Questions
What types of drinking water filtration systems are available? There are various options including point-of-use filters, reverse osmosis units, and whole-house systems designed to improve water quality throughout a property.
How do I know if my water needs filtration? Signs include a strange taste or odor, visible sediment, or mineral buildup on fixtures, indicating that filtration may be beneficial.
What contaminants can water filtration remove? Filtration can reduce substances such as chlorine, sediment, heavy metals, and certain bacteria, depending on the system installed.
Are maintenance requirements for water filtration systems? Regular filter replacements and system inspections are typically needed to ensure continued effectiveness and water quality.
